Attitude to the EU, the institutions of the EU, the European Elections, the EU enlargement and the Euro. Topics: 1. general questions on Europe and the Euro and political extent to which informed: personal opinion leadership; interest in politics; interest in politics in one´s circle of friends; general contentment with life; satisfaction with democracy at the level of the European Union and one´s own country; self-assessment of knowledge about the European Union; desire for more information about the EU; EU topics about which more information is desired; most important sources of information about the policies and institution of the EU; preferred information channels and information media about the EU; interest in direct EU information through a telephone or fax hotline or computer; frequency of use of news broadcasts on the radio and television as well as reading news in newspapers; possibility to use video recorder, fax, satellite television, pay TV, teletext, computer, CD-ROM, modem and Internet; attitude to membership of the country in the EU; advantageousness of EU membership for one´s own country; expected development of a self-image as European or remaining member citizen of the nation-state; knowledge about the designation of the future European currency; assessment of probability of introduction of the European currency after 1999; knowledge test about the accompanying circumstances in introduction and the later development of the Euro; self-classification of extent to which informed about the Euro; attitude to an information campaign before introduction of the new currency; sources of information about the European currency up to now; approval of a common currency and a European Central bank; attitude to a common European foreign and security policy; attitude to a European responsibility for all questions not solved at national level; demand for support of the European Commission by the majority of the European Parliament; desire for school instruction about the European institutions and support of European film and television productions by the EU; preference for national decision-making authority or decision at European level in selected political areas; preferred new members of the EU; most important criteria for accepting new EU members (scale); attitude to an expansion of the EU and most important effects of an increase in the European Union (scale); future expectations, hopes and fears for the new millenium (scale); significance of the European Parliament and desire for a stronger position of the parliament; election participation at the last European Election and intended participation in the election to the European Parliament in June 1999; representation citizen interests by the European Parliament; areas in which the European Parliament should play a more significant role. In the United Kingdom the following was additionally asked: knowledge about the British presidency of the EU; importance of the presidency in the council of ministers. 2. interest in politics; self-assessment of political extent to which informed and political knowledge; assessment of the influence of politics on personal life; desire for more political interest; importance of areas of life; frequency of political discussions in school; most important sources for political information; knowledge about the number of member countries in the EU; membership in clubs and organizations. 3. knowledge about the Basque region; general attitude to the Basques; knowledge about the the Basque region belonging to Spain or France; development of the Basque region in comparison to Spain; personal trip and reason for the trip to the Basque region. 4. questions on consumption of food and use of product information: assessment of the harmlessness of selected food products; most important guarantors for the safety and harmlessness of food products; necessity of increased checks to increase the safety of food products; materials contained that jeopardize the harmlessness of food; preferred place of purchase of harmless food; assessment of the credibility of producers, small grocery stores, supermarkets, consumer organizations as well as national or European institutions regarding the safety of food; preference for symbols or written description of the quality and harmlessness of food; product information on the packaging; frequency of reading best by date, list of materials contained, calorie information, country of origin, quality seal, recommendations for use and storage notes; attitude to precise information on product contents and product effects; attitude to a Europe-wide uniform meaning of light products; knowledge about the E-Numbers under the materials contained; attitude to protection of symbols such as ´Bio´; credibility of the product information on the packaging and conveying adequate information; attitude to identification of genetically modified products; assessment of the preference of manufacturers and distributors for safe or profitable products. 5. questions on the public health system: satisfaction with the public health system in the country; attitude to a basic governmental support in the public health system and private provision beyond this; attitude to a priority for care for young patients rather than older; knowledge about the European campaign against cancer; interest in information about early diagnosis signs of cancer. In Germany, France, Italy, the Netherlands, Great Britain and Sweden the following was additionally asked: judgement on the income situation of household; self-classification of condition of health; contact with doctors in the last two weeks; hospital stay in the last year; attitude to a unlimited support of all treatments; preferred decider about establishing permitted and affordable treatments; preferred bearer of the deficits in the public health system; preferred criteria for establishing the priority of treating patients and illnesses given hypothetical scarce financial resources (scale); assumed inclination of the majority of people on the one hand as well as respondent on the other to to to the doctor for a selection of minor and serious illness symptoms (scale); judgement on the precaution chances with cancer. 6. cancer check-up: women were asked: attitude to cancer check-up and selected precaution tests (scale); willingness to participate in a national screening program; source of information about the information campaign run by the European Union on the topic of cancer; talks with experts about cancer; cancer check-ups conducted in the last few months or planned in the near future. Men were asked: participation in prostate cancer and further cancer check-ups in the last three years. 7. sex tourism: knowledge of sex tourism with children; frequency of discussions with persons over 25 years as well as with persons under 25 years about this topic; assumption about the spread of sex tourismus with children; assumed countries and continents in which sex tourism with children takes place; assumptions about the world-wide increase or decrease of sex tourism; characterization of participants in sex tourism with children; assumed reasons for this sex tourism; assessment of sex tourism with children as illegal, morally reprehensible, not acceptable and avoidable; assumed connections of sex tourism with children to other social problems, such as e.g. poverty, child abuse, crime or drug abuse; knowledge about national legal situation regarding sex tourism with children; preferred governmental measures and governmental measures actually conducted in one´s country in the fight against sex tourism with children; desirability of the effort of the European Union in this area; attention on national campaigns against this sex tourism and assessment of the effectiveness of such campaigns; personal conduct in case of noticing of sex tourism in one´s circle of friends; avoiding destinations well-known for sex tourism with children; personal contact with this topic in a vacation place. Demography: nationality; self-classification on a left-right continuum; marital status; age at conclusion of school education; sex; age; size of household; composition of household; professional position; head of household; professional position of head of household; party preference; household income; possession of a telephone. Interviewer rating: number of persons present during the interview; willingness of respondent to cooperate. Also encoded was: date of interview; start of interview; length of interview; city size.
